Why this update matters

At first glance, many updates seem like minor UI tweaks — a refreshed lobby, brighter chips, or a prettier avatar frame. But real influence comes from changes to matchmaking, anti-cheat systems, reward pacing, and tournament formats. The last few updates focused on improving fairness and long-term engagement; this one continues that trend while introducing social features that shift how crews coordinate and compete.

Think of the game as a card table in a coffee shop. Small changes to seating rules (matchmaking) or how the host enforces order (anti-cheat) alter the entire rhythm of play. If the update moves the table closer to a well-lit window — clearer signals about opponents, fairer games — the overall experience improves. If it simply replaces the tablecloth, the core game remains the same. This update mixes both: some clear fairness wins and a few cosmetic upgrades that still deliver better clarity and usability.

Practical steps to adapt quickly

  1. Update and review patch notes: Confirm the specifics on official channels — new rules often include subtle text that matters.
  2. Reassess your opening ranges: Trim two or three marginal hands from your usual range in balanced games.
  3. Practice in low-stakes or freeroll events: Use the revamped short-format tournaments to test adjustments with minimal downside.
  4. Form a small test crew: Run internal scrimmages to get comfortable with shared-pool mechanics and crew scheduling tools.
  5. Track your stats: Use in-game history to monitor win-rate across different table types, and pivot your strategy where you see leaks.

Security, fairness, and trust

One of the most consequential aspects of the update is the focus on trust signals and anti-cheat. Reliable detection systems reduce collusion and bot play, which directly improves game quality. When you play on a platform where fairness is measurable and visible, your long-term expected value is higher — not because payouts increase, but because variance from foul play decreases.

Practical tip: Prefer tables with visible trust indicators when stakes are meaningful. In a platform with clear badges or dispute-free streaks, you’re less likely to encounter edge cases that skew results unfairly.

Long-term implications for competitive play

Over time, better matchmaking and anti-cheat measures raise the baseline skill level at common stakes. That creates a more meritocratic ladder where consistent study and disciplined play reward you more reliably. If you’re serious about climbing, invest in review — analyze key hands, adapt to shorter tournament dynamics, and groom a tight core crew for practice.

Analogy: If the competitive scene is a mountain, this update clears some of the underbrush that made the climb random. The trail is more worn now; you still need a good pack (skills and crew) and consistent pace to reach the summit.
